Select the most appropriate meaning of the given Idiom:-

An acid test 

Options:

Pouring acid on something

To take an important part

A critical test

Suspect something foul

Correct Answer:

A critical test

Explanation:

The most appropriate meaning of the idiom "an acid test" is a critical test. The idiom comes from the fact that acid is a strong substance that can dissolve or destroy other substances. In this sense, an acid test is a test that is so difficult or challenging that it will reveal the true nature of something.
